Biography
Frank Pierson (May 12, 1925 - July 23, 2012) was an American writer, producer and director for film and television, honoured with an Academy Award in the category "Best Writing, Original Screenplay" for the movie "Dog Day Afternoon". He was a Harvard graduate with an BA in Cultural Anthropology.
